Let it be known to the board that in addition to President Kennedy's guidelines, President Jimmy Carter consolidated all federal agencies that were required by law to follow the affirmative action plan into the Department of Labor. Before Carter did this, each agency-handled affirmative action in its own individual way, some were not as consistent as other agencies were. He created the Office of Federal Contract compliance Program (OFCCP) in 1978 to ensure compliance with the affirmative action policies. (Department of Labor 2008)
